NRC Premium Activated Carbon is specially developed for refilling breathing air and Nitrox filter cartridges. It provides a reliable and cost-effective way to extend the service life of your air filtration systems – ideal for compressors, diving equipment, and air purification systems.
| Manufacturer | NRC International |
| Product Type | Premium extruded activated carbon |
| Grain Size | Approx. 1–2 mm |
| BET Surface Area | ≈ 1250 m²/g |
| Abrasion Hardness | ≈ 98 % |
| Ash Content | ≈ 8 % |
| Bulk Density | ≈ 500 ± 30 g/L |
| Ignition Point | ≈ 400 °C |
| Moisture Content | Max. 5% (at packaging) |
| Shelf Life | Approx. 18 months (sealed) |
Warning: Moist activated carbon may adsorb oxygen from the air. In closed or partially closed environments, this can lead to oxygen depletion. Follow all applicable safety regulations and product handling guidelines.
NRC activated carbon can be thermally reactivated when saturated. Through heating at temperatures above 850 °C, adsorbed organic compounds are removed, allowing the carbon to be reused effectively.
